Home

Description

A vulnerability has been found in SourceCodester Simple Doctors Appointment System up to 1.0. This issue affects some unknown processing of the file /doctors_appointment/admin/ajax.php?action=save_category. Such manipulation of the argument img leads to unrestricted upload. The attack may be performed from remote. The exploit has been disclosed to the public and may be used.

PUBLISHED Reserved 2026-03-30 | Published 2026-03-31 | Updated 2026-03-31 | Assigner VulDB




MEDIUM: 5.3CVSS:4.0/AV:N/AC:L/AT:N/PR:L/UI:N/VC:L/VI:L/VA:L/SC:N/SI:N/SA:N/E:P
MEDIUM: 6.3C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:L/I:L/A:L/E:P/RL:X/RC:R
MEDIUM: 6.3CVSS:3.0/AV:N/AC:L/PR:L/UI:N/S:U/C:L/I:L/A:L/E:P/RL:X/RC:R
6.5AV:N/AC:L/Au:S/C:P/I:P/A:P/E:POC/RL:ND/RC:UR

Problem types

Unrestricted Upload

Improper Access Controls

Product status

1.0
affected

Timeline

2026-03-30:Advisory disclosed
2026-03-30:VulDB entry created
2026-03-30:VulDB entry last update

Credits

dyh18 (VulDB User) reporter

References

vuldb.com/vuln/354249 (VDB-354249 | SourceCodester Simple Doctors Appointment System ajax.php unrestricted upload) vdb-entry technical-description

vuldb.com/vuln/354249/cti (VDB-354249 | CTI Indicators (IOB, IOC, TTP, IOA)) signature permissions-required

vuldb.com/submit/780375 (Submit #780375 | SourceCodester Simple Doctor's Appointment System 1.0 Unrestricted Upload) third-party-advisory

github.com/dyh1213-wq/cve/issues/5 exploit issue-tracking

www.sourcecodester.com/ product

cve.org (CVE-2026-5181)

nvd.nist.gov (CVE-2026-5181)

Download JSON